Annual 444 Walk


We would like to invite you to partner with us for the 2nd Annual 444 Mile Walk on the Natchez Trace Parkway. This event is so epic that it takes place over a full 30 days in the month of April! The impact this event will have on the autistic community cannot be measured.

Brad Meshell, co-founder of Jacob's Audible, decided in 2022 to honor his son, Jacob, and raise awareness by walking the Natchez Trace from Natchez, MS to Nashville, TN. This involved walking 15 miles a day for 30 days along the two-lane Natchez Trace Parkway.

Because of how successful, meaningful, and unifying this experience has been, Brad has called for this to become an annual event, with proceeds benefiting Jacob’s Audible.

This year the walk will include stops in 23 communities along the trace crossing 3 states. This will give local organizations the opportunity to highlight their available resources in support of the autism community.
